Journalist, Activist Attacked In Georgia's Breakaway Abkhazia

Four people wearing masks attacked journalist Devid Gobechia and activist Lia Agrba in Georgia's breakaway region of Abkhazia. Abkhazia's de facto Interior Ministry said on September 15 that police are investigating the incident. The statement came shortly after Gobechia said the attackers used pepper spray against him and Agrba, seriously injuring their eyes. He added that the attackers filmed him being beaten and took away a bag that Agrba was carrying. Gobechia said he had been followed for days before the attack. Earlier in September, Agrba filed a complaint with the de facto Prosecutor-General's Office, accusing a member of an advisory body to the region's leader of slander.
